Overview of the General Manager role

You will hire great people and develop associates for future growth. You will provide leadership to achieve or exceed budgeted sales, payroll, and controllable expense goals.

You will effectively manage store operations, maintain appropriate inventory levels, and maintain visual merchandising standards.

You will ensure that all internal and external customers receive exemplary customer service and have a positive store / brand experience.

You will ensure that sales associates build relationships with customers.

Responsibilities

  • Ensure store meets or exceeds sales and contest goals and meet payroll goals based on current trends
  • Prioritize, plan, and adjust schedules and daily agendas to meet business goals; hold team accountable to achieving goals
  • Train and motivate all associates through on-going programs in sales, customer service, and product knowledge
  • Assess performance and provide on-going feedback
  • Complete and deliver performance appraisals and development plans
  • Ensure team provides an exceptional customer experience in the store to achieve world-class service standards
  • Maintain presence through effective floor management and ensure staff coverage in all areas of the store as needed
  • Create and maintain an environment where all associates are treated fairly and with dignity and respect, in accordance with our "People First" philosophy
  • Work with District Managers and peers to develop best practices in store management

Criteria

  • Proven ability to manage staff to exceed sales goals, while meeting payroll goals
  • Proven to identify top talent, create teams, and train / develop / retain great people
  • Proven ability to think through complex issues, and allocate time to execute multiple tasks and changing priorities
  • Proven ability to motivate and influence others through personal actions and examples
  • Effective communication, organization and leadership skills
  • 4 + years management experience in specialty retail and / or multi-unit retail business environment

Physical Requirements

  • Must be able to be mobile on the sales floor for extended periods of time
  • Must be able to lift and mobilize medium to large items, up to 75 lbs., while utilizing appropriate equipment and safety techniques
  • Employment / promotion to this role will be contingent on successful completion of a background check
  • Full time associates are expected to have open availability to meet the needs of the business.

Benefits Just for You

This role offers a competitive compensation package including pay and benefits. Pay is based on several factors including but not limited to education, work experience, certifications, geographic location etc.

The anticipated pay range for this role will be : $67,000-$85,000 / annual salary.

Depending on your position and your location, here are a few highlights of what you might be eligible for :

  • A generous discount on all Williams-Sonoma, Inc. brands
  • A 401(k) plan and other investment opportunities
  • Paid vacations and holidays
  • Health benefits, dental and vision insurance, including same-sex domestic partner benefits
  • A wellness program that supports your physical, financial and emotional health

Your Journey in Continued Learning

  • Individual development plans and career pathing conversations
  • Annual performance appraisals
  • Cross-brand and cross-functional career opportunities
  • Online learning opportunities through brand specific resources and WSI University
  • Leadership development opportunities
